Movies of James Flavin and Roy Roberts together

James Flavin and Roy Roberts have starred in 7 movies together. Their first film was Circumstantial Evidence in 1945. The most recent movie that James Flavin and Roy Roberts starred together was It's a Mad, Mad, Mad, Mad World in 1963.
